Description

SPIKA is the perfect all-purpose axe for the forest life. It has the same type of head as the Hults Bruk Akka forester’s axe, but the handle is shorter - 17.5 inches long - making the axe more portable. The shorter handle also allows for working with the axe closer to your body. The axe head is hand forged at the historic Hults Bruk, a forge that has been in operation since 1697 - blackened, hand-finished, razor-sharp with a polished edge. Each axe head is made from high-quality Swedish axe steel, expertly tempered to hold a very sharp edge even after repeated sharpening. The curved handle is made from American hickory, sanded and protected with linseed oil and engraved with the HB logo. The axe is ideal for precision work such as carving, whittling, or building fire stands or shelters around a camp site. A well-proportioned hand notch allows you to grip around the head and steer the axe with maximum control. The semi-straight edge with a flat and wide grind allows the axe to rest firmly against the work piece. With its slightly curved edge the axe can be used for light forestry work such as clearing a path or trail-maintenance. The head is slightly thicker over the cheeks, giving it good splitting capabilities for chopping firewood. The axe also features a curved narrow handle with a pronounced end knob for a more secure grip.
